Luxury glamping safari tent set in 25acres of meadows,woods and with its own stream.Hidden Meadows is the perfect place to relax and get back to nature.We have included too many things to list here so please check out our website or give us a call for more information

A fantastic glamping experience - so well equipped. The photos and the info are absolutely right - the safari tent is totally equipped and you do just need to turn up, put the kettle on the camp cooker and cut yourself a slice of the cake baked by Lynne, whilst you sit on the deck and take in your surroundings. Wellies are a necessity (the one thing we didn't bring!) for walking from the car to the meadow where your camping experience starts - not quite a short walk, but ok to carry your bags as you need only take clothes - the owners have thought of absolutely everything you may need and our most memorable night was the one where we lit a camp fire later in the evening after our BBQ dinner, and toasted marshmallows (also provided)!

The owners are very friendly, are very happy to oblige with requests, but unobtrusive whilst you are there. We had meat from the local butcher, bread from the bakers, and milk delivered to us, tea shops found and a table for dinner booked. We have already booked our return trip in the summer & aim to see more of the site and the surrounding area and fully partake of the exclusive camping experience. All facilities are second to none and the pictures do not do it justice.
